Richard T. Johnson

Richard T. Johnson, 89, of Altoona, died March 21, 2026, at UPMC Altoona after an extended illness. He was the son of the late Joseph Johnson Jr. and Elsie Carland. Surviving is his wife, Eunice (McGarvey) Johnson; children: Danny, Bunny and Sue; sisters and brother: Debbie, Toni and Ralph. He was preceded in death by a son, Jeffery. At the request of the deceased, there will be no public viewing. Arrangements are by Anthony P. Scaglione Funeral Home.

Roseann L. Tornatore

Roseann L Tornatore, 93, of Altoona, passed away March 20, 2026. Born Dec. 15, 1932, in Gallitzin, she was the daughter of the late Stephen and Kathryn Gargon. She was preceded by her husband, Frank A. Tornatore. Friends will be received from 10 to 11 a.m. Tuesday, March 24, at the Gibbons-Houser Funeral Home Inc., 301 Church St., Gallitzin. A funeral Mass will follow at 11 a.m. Tuesday at St. Demetrius Roman Catholic Church, Gallitzin, the Rev. Fr. Albert Ledoux, celebrant. Interment will be at St. Patrick’s Cemetery. David Lee Dively

David Lee Dively, 69, of Queen, passed away Tuesday at his home. He was born in Roaring Spring, son of the late Wilmer and Sarah “Sally” (Moore) Dively. David was a graduate of Claysburg-Kimmel High School and worked for HH Brown Shoe Co. Surviving are sons, Joseph Dively (wife, Lisa) and Jake Dively (Amanda Baker); grandchildren: Kyle, Hope and Aden; and a brother, Dale Dively (wife, Brandy). At the request of the deceased and his family, no services will be held. Arrangements by Fink & Stone Funeral Home and Cremation Services Inc., Woodbury.
